The three highest charting Billboard country tracks were \u003cspan style=\"font-style: italic ;\"\u003eCouldn't Do Nothin' Right\u003c\/span\u003e at No. 15, \u003cspan style=\"font-style: italic ;\"\u003eNo Memories Hangin' 'Round\u003c\/span\u003e, a duet with Bobby Bare, at No. 17, and \u003cspan style=\"font-style: italic ;\"\u003eTake Me, Take Me\u003c\/span\u003e at No. 25.  A reviewer on allmusic.com says, \"On her debut American release (she'd done a record in Germany that she now disowns), Rosanne Cash may not have shaken the money tree or the Billboard charts, but she and husband\/producer\/collaborator Rodney Crowell began to change the face of contemporary country music forever. Recorded in L.A. and not Nash Vegas, \u003cspan style=\"font-style: italic ;\"\u003eRight or Wrong\u003c\/span\u003e still utilized talent synonymous with Music City, but the sound that took country and merged it with the rock and pop styles of the day was a winning formula.\" \u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Record Vision","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":52793637667097,"sku":"JC-36155","price":10.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0992\/6937\/8329\/files\/LP-rosanne_cash-right_or_wrong-03.jpg?v=1783553840","url":"https:\/\/record-vision.myshopify.com\/products\/jc-36155","provider":"Record Vision","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
